Penguins Made of Olives Stuffed with Cream Cheese

Description

Philadelphia cheese can be substituted with other types of cream cheese. Carrots can be used either raw or cooked.

Ingredients

  • Pitted olives 1 can
  • Semi-soft cream cheese 0 oz
  • Carrot 1 piece

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1

Drain the excess liquid from the can of olives.

Step 2

Cut a wedge from 1 olive and fill it with cream cheese through the resulting hole. You can use a small bag with the top cut off, similar to a pastry bag, or do this with a small spoon or even your finger.

Step 3

Slice the carrot into rounds.

Step 4

Cut a small piece from a carrot round and insert it into another olive so that the pointed end is outside.

Step 5

Now stack the olives on top of each other and on the carrot round, and pierce them from top to bottom with a toothpick.
